Waqf property administration in Bangladesh: Challenges and recommendations

Abstract
Bangladesh is muddling through the delinquent of poverty since its freedom. Recent success stories of the nation in lessening poverty have been the outcome of the efforts of more than a few public and private initiatives. As a Muslim majority country, Bangladesh is yet to slot in Islamic vehicles of poverty reduction in the national development strategies. Waqf an Islamic charitable endowment has played significant roles in the socio-economic spheres of Muslim people all over the world since the dawn of Islam. During colonial era, Waqf as social institution became quiescent in Muslim majority countries and could not function appropriately. Now Muslim intellectuals and policy makers have recognized that resurgence of waqf as a strong social institution can act as a catalyst in mobilization of funds in poor Muslim majority countries for financing socio-economic projects including much needed poverty alleviation. As the third largest Muslim majority country in the world, Bangladesh can explore waqf as an operative tool in social development. Though having a large number of waqf in Bangladesh over the few centuries, they could not play effective roles following the maladministration and lack of proper structuring and innovation. With proper structuring and administration, waqf can be a boon for Bangladesh, a poor country blessed with 160 million people with 23% poor people. This study will basically focus on the history and administration of Waqf Property and present scenario of them in Bangladesh. It will also discuss in-depth the major challenges and obstacles to the administration of Waqf Property in Bangladesh. The author at last will provide some recommendations which will help the government, government agencies, lawyers and scholars to meet the challenges. In this study, there are some specific suggestions and recommendations that deserve serious consideration for the proper administration of Waqf property in Bangladesh
